    Summer Adult Faith Opportunity: Bishop Robert Barron presents “David the King,” this summer’s adult faith opportunity. Explore the compelling stories of King David and understand his foreshadowing of Jesus Christ, the King of Kings. Sessions will begin May 29 and conclude July 10, 7-9p.m. in the school multi- purpose room. Pre-ordered guides can be picked up the first night. Cost is $25.00.

    Memorial Day Prayer On this day, we remember those who have served us by protecting our freedoms. When we celebrate our long weekend with friends and family, help us remember that our freedom to speak of you, to worship you, and to do that which we ought to do have all been bought at the price and sacrifice of many lives. Your Son died for our eternal life in Heaven. So too, your children died protecting us here on earth. Help us be mindful this week-end and always of the sacrifices made by those in uniform. Amen

    2019 TMIY Summer Session June 2 - August 11 St. Mary School

    TMIY will be hosting an adult summer study session in 2019. Meeting time is Sunday mornings, 8:30 to 9:45a.m. in the school multipurpose room. The sessions are not limited to TMIY members only. Anyone 18 or over is welcome to attend. The Bible and the Sacraments is based on the work of world renowned theologian Dr. Scott Hahn. Presented by popular speaker and author Matthew Leonard, the deep mysteries and truths of the sacraments come alive in a whole new way. June 2 - Lesson One: Introduction to the Mysteries June 9 - Lesson Two: The Ritual of Family June 16 - Lesson Three: The Waters of Salvation (Baptism)
